Output 8459e773d13dd318040d47ffa550eafb80177b28d36801e71f1a1abce610e83c:1

value
25672950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2c815a94fe317ec7c974f0c655916d3feb21c63 OP_EQUALVERIFY OP_CHECKSIG
address
1P8iDYenVrmnVmX9ez6fsenkuk5foc2AjD
transaction
8459e773d13dd318040d47ffa550eafb80177b28d36801e71f1a1abce610e83c
confirmations
559470
spent
true